Chris was gone from the show by then--it was just around the time in November 1981 when they went to the new format (first to $500/crossover after three puzzles solved/progressive jackpot in Alphabetics) that they changed the intro.  By then, the show had been on almost three years.  Speculation--since it had been on almost three years the "It's more than just PASSWORD. . ." seemed a bit superfluous.

Also at the same time, the billing was changed for Kennedy to be the "star" of P+ instead of the "host."

Of course, it was during the pilot that Carol Burnett quipped, "It's more than Password, it's Password Plus", leading the producers to change the name.
No it wasn't. The pilot was taped the Thursday or Friday before the Monday we debuted. By then Bente's set festooned with "+" signs (and swastikas if you look at them the wrong way) had been built and the title had been printed all over tickets, press releases and TV Guide. The neon sign on the set had been built. By the pilot taping it was too late to change the name of the show.

I can't vouch for the Carol Burnett story. The only run-thru I'm aware of, which was taped before I went to work there, was with Linda Kaye Henning and (IIRC) Richard Paul. I'm not aware of any office run-thrus with Carol Burnett. I can say that the P+ office on the 4th floor at 6430 Sunset faced east and overlooked Vine Street where there was a chain record store called "Music Plus" at 1440 Vine street. That is more likely the inspiration for the "Password Plus" title.

And to add further fuel to the fire, when Eubanks did the walk-on on the 1/5/79 CS ep to promote ALL-STAR SECRETS, Perry mentioned that "also, PASSWORD PLUS will debut this coming Monday."  And the CS episode was taped in late 1978 (probably early December), before the P+ pilot had even been taped.
